Description & Estimates







Public records show 2, Meadow Walk, High Wycombe to be a mid-century freehold house with 893 ft2 of internal area, sitting on a 233 m2 plot.
In this area, houses of this size normally have 3 bedrooms with a garden.
2, Meadow Walk, High Wycombe has an estimated sale value of £467,686 and an estimated rental value of £1,957 per month, assuming reasonable condition and based on the information available.
Meadow Walk, Penn, High Wycombe, HP10 lies within the HP10 postal district.

Energy Efficiency
2, Meadow Walk, High Wycombe has an Energy Performance Rating (EPC) of D. This is based on the most recent assessment, dated 04 Oct 2023.
The property is connected to mains gas and has fully double glazed windows. It is heated using Boiler and radiators, mains gas.
Sold Prices
2, Meadow Walk, High Wycombe last changed hands on 21st June 2024, selling for £450,000. The transaction was logged as a freehold house by HM Land Registry.
That is its only recorded sale since 1995.
The market for similar properties has dropped by 8.5% since June 2024.
